Anyway, I haven't posted anything as I was very busy with a SME training at BULOLO. The Attendance was a blast as seen in the photos below. It was attended by mainly women folks with late inclusion of youths and fathers who have come to witnessed.

The Training was facilitated by MOROBE RURAL SME FOUNDATION INC FOR HOUN GULF. In conjunction with BULOLO COUNCIL OF WOMEN. The Training was conducted in three paces.

1. The Starters

2. The Beginners

3. The Advanced.

The starters are those who have no single idea in business and wanted to know how to start business and register business. The Beginners are those who know something about business, registered their businesses already but have problem in maintaining their accounts, and also to access loan products with the banks. The Advance group are the ones who have fair idea in both 1 and 2 but have problems in doing cashflow, budgets, business proposals, business planning and such.

ISSUES

When I was conducting the training, I have noticed few problems that were prevalent since.

1. Registering their businesses with IPA

2. Filling forms

3. Getting TIN certificate

4. Do business profile

5. Opening of business account with banks.

SOLUTIONS

After seeing the problems they had, Me and Ezra with our team have actually assisted practically again to fill their forms and registered their businesses. We have progressed well and REGISTRED A TOTAL OF 130 business names with IPA. IT WAS A TOTAL SUCCESS!!!

MOROBE RURAL SME FOUNDATION also liased directly with IRC Lae office to assist all those women folks we registred in Bulolo with IPA certificates. To solve their issues of bank account openings, we invited BSP BULOLO to come during the training and they also did presentation on their products and promised to open the bank accounts for all the business names already registered. I also gave samples of business profile to the executives of the women council to assist the poor mothers.

CONCLUSIONS

WHILE MANY OF US ARE JUST DOING TRAININGS IN SME LITERACY. THE PROBLEMS OF THE PEOPLE REMAINS SAME.

1. IPA TOO SLOW TO REGISTER BUSINESSES,

2. MOST WHO HAVE HIGH INTEREST IN DOING BUSINESSES HAVE LITTLE KNOWLEDGE IN FILLING FORMS,

3. IRC TOO SLOW IN PROCESSING TIN CERTIFICATES,

4. BANK ACCOUNT OPENINGS HAVE REQUIREMENTS LIKE BUSINESSE PROFILE WHICH CANNOT BE DONE BY RURAL POPULATION.
